蜘蛛池是SEO行业中一个非常重要的工具,它可以帮助站长更好地管理和控制搜索引擎爬虫的访问行为。在了解蜘蛛池的原理和用途之前,我们需要先了解一下什么是搜索引擎爬虫。
搜索引擎爬虫(也称为蜘蛛、机器人)是搜索引擎的核心组成部分,它们通过自动化程序来浏览互联网上的网页,并将这些网页的信息存入搜索引擎的数据库中。搜索引擎爬虫按照一定的算法和策略来选择需要爬取的页面,并通过页面之间的链接进行跳转和爬取。搜索引擎的索引数据主要来自于爬虫的爬取行为。
蜘蛛池是站长为了更好地管理和控制搜索引擎爬虫的访问行为而采用的一种技术手段。蜘蛛池的原理主要包括两个部分:用户代理识别和访问控制。
首先,蜘蛛池需要通过分析搜索引擎爬虫发送的请求中的User-Agent字段来判断该请求是否来自于合法的搜索引擎爬虫。每个搜索引擎的爬虫都有自己独特的User-Agent标识,站长可以通过收集、分析和整理这些User-Agent标识,建立起一个用于识别爬虫的数据库。当蜘蛛池接受到来自于搜索引擎的请求时,通过对比请求中的User-Agent值与数据库中的记录,从而判断出该请求是否来自于搜索引擎爬虫。
在确认请求来自于合法的搜索引擎爬虫后,蜘蛛池还需要根据站长的设定,对不同爬虫的访问行为进行控制。蜘蛛池可以设置每个爬虫的最大并发访问数、访问频次、抓取深度等参数。通过合理地设置这些参数,站长可以更好地控制和平衡搜索引擎爬虫对网站的爬取行为,减少对服务器资源的过度消耗,并提升网站的性能和稳定性。
蜘蛛池在SEO行业中有着广泛的应用和重要的价值,主要体现在以下几个方面。
蜘蛛池可以帮助站长筛选和过滤非法的或恶意的爬虫请求,提高网站的安全性。通过对比已知的合法搜索引擎爬虫的User-Agent,蜘蛛池可以有效地屏蔽那些伪造或冒充搜索引擎爬虫身份的非法请求,防止恶意爬虫对网站进行攻击和数据盗取。
通过合理地控制不同搜索引擎爬虫的访问行为,蜘蛛池可以为站长提供更好的爬取效果。例如,可以设置爬虫的最小访问间隔时间,避免爬虫过于频繁地访问网站,从而减少对网站服务器的负载压力,提升网站的响应速度和用户体验。
蜘蛛池可以实时监控和记录搜索引擎爬虫的访问行为,例如访问时间、访问页面等。通过对这些数据的分析和统计,站长可以了解搜索引擎爬虫的爬取情况,掌握搜索引擎对网站的关注程度,为网站的优化和推广提供参考。
综上所述,蜘蛛池作为一个用于管理和控制搜索引擎爬虫的工具,在SEO行业中具有重要的作用。它不仅可以帮助站长保护网站安全,优化爬取效率,还能对爬取状态进行监控,为网站的优化和推广提供依据。对于站长来说,了解和应用蜘蛛池是提升网站品质和用户体验的重要一环。